Swampmoose's 2002 Ford F-150 Lightning

Built motor(All Manley forged bottom end)

Kenne Bell 2.3l w/ jlp sheetmetal intake

JLP ported heads(a lot of extra port work)

Comp Stage 2 cams

JLP Sheetmetal upper intake

JDM 108mm intake tube/MAF housing

Ported Lower intake(and just about anything else that can be ported)

SCT 2400 MAF

Accufab single blade throttle body

JLP EGR delete

Twin Walbro 255's

60lb injectors

SS braided lines from tank to rail

JDM electric fan with 170* t-stat

Navigator water pump

AVT twin oil separators

JDM heat exchanger

LFP intercooler reservior

Kooks long tube headers

JDM catless midpiple with veracious resonators

JDM silver bullet catback

Strange 10 way adjustable rear shocks(modded so both face rear)

QA1 10 way adjustable front shocks

JDM front drag sprigs

2" drop shackles

Calipers modded to fit 15" drag wheels

Driveshaft loop

JLP traction bars

PI 2400 stall

 4X4 trans pan

JDM line mod valve

Street tune- 10lb lower w/3.5" upper

Race tune- 10lb lower w/3.0" upper(also have a 2.8 upper which would be around 20lbs... haven't needed that yet!)

and a bunch of other custom stuff(custom ram air tubes/hood, intercooler and electric fan switches for track use, a-pillar with wideband a/f and boost gauge... blah blah blah)

 

Dyno #'s

593rwhp/613rwtq(street tune/only 14lbs)

649rwhp/701rwtq(race tune/18lbs)

It's been 6.91@101 in the 1/8th on the race setup(which should be easily in the 10's in the 1/4)
